Before booking a concrete pro in Topeka, homeowners can check for signs of existing drainage issues around their driveways or patios. Look for standing water after rain or cracks that seem to be widening over time. These are indicators that the underlying base may be compromised. The specialists who come out will assess these conditions thoroughly. They understand that Topeka's climate, with its hot summers and cold winters, puts stress on concrete surfaces. The crew that arrives will explain how they prepare the ground, ensuring proper slope for water runoff and compacting the base material. They'll discuss the concrete mix, reinforcement options, and finishing techniques, whether you're opting for a standard finish or stamped concrete. They'll also explain the importance of expansion joints. This detailed approach ensures the work done is built to last. You'll get a clear understanding of the materials and the installation steps.
